The Interprofessional Practice and Learning team facilitates and advances person-centered care through evidence-based professional practice and learning strategies and programs that are designed provincially and implemented locally to enhance collaborative learning and practice. The Interprofessional Practice and Learning team takes a leadership role in creating a culture of collaboration with a focus on team-based care, evidence-informed practice, and learning and professional development to improve health outcomes for patients, families and communities. Through strong partnerships with the academic sector, regulators, and government, the Interprofessional Practice and Learning team has an integral role in influencing and operationalizing health system priorities.

**About You**:
We would love to hear from you if you have the following:
- Completion of a recognized Critical Care Paramedic program required
- Three (3) years Clinical experience within the past 5 years as a Critical Care Paramedic in an Emergency Department setting required
- Active licensure with the College of Paramedics of Nova Scotia required
- Current Basic Cardiac Life Support (BCLS) and Advanced Cardiac Life Support (ACLS) required
- Advanced Trauma and Life Support (ATLS), Crisis Resource Management, Advanced Interventions and Management in Emergencies, Procedural Sedation and Analgesia Course, and Simulation are required or willing to obtain
- Competency in ED specific skills including ITLS, casting and suturing, procedural sedation required
- Recent evidence of leadership development and/or experience
- Knowledge of and experience with program development, implementation, and evaluation
- Experience working in a fast-paced, high stress, multi-disciplinary environment an asset
- Skilled in the facilitation of concept-based learning, collaborative learning and practice development
- Ability to delegate, problem solve and resolve conflict
- Evidence of effective interpersonal and communication skills in a variety of contexts
- Computer skills including, Microsoft Suite (Excel, Word, Outlook, PowerPoint) and computer documentations systems
- Competencies in other languages an asset, French preferred
